What is Gibbs phenomenon
Explain the Gibbs phenomenon?
Expert
One probable way of finding the FIR filter that approximates H(ejω) could be to reduce the infinite Fourier series at n= ± (N-1/2). Sudden truncation of series will results in the oscillation both in the pass band and is stop band .This mechanism is called as the Gibbs phenomenon .
